Cardiovascular Disease (heart attack, stroke, peripheral vascular disease) Nephropathy (kidney damage) Retinopathy (blindness) Peripheral Neuropathy (loss of sensation, autonomic dysfunction) Foot Ulcers (amputation) Several large prospective studies have demonstrated that diabetic complications can be significantly reduced by effective glycemic control
